logo

DeepSeek云端部署指南:打造高效专属AI助手

作者:Nicky2025.09.17 15:32浏览量:0

简介:本文深入解析DeepSeek崛起背景下,开发者如何在云端快速部署专属AI助手,涵盖架构设计、技术选型、部署优化及安全策略,提供从零到一的完整实践方案。

一、DeepSeek崛起:AI助手部署的技术革命

在AI大模型竞争白热化的当下,DeepSeek凭借其独特的混合专家架构(MoE)和动态路由算法,在推理效率与成本控制上实现突破。相较于传统大模型,DeepSeek的轻量化设计使其在云端部署时具备显著优势:单卡可承载更大参数规模,推理延迟降低40%,且支持弹性扩展。这一特性使其成为中小企业构建专属AI助手的理想选择。

技术层面,DeepSeek的核心创新体现在三方面:

  1. 动态计算分配:通过门控网络实时调整激活的专家模块,避免无效计算;
  2. 稀疏激活机制:仅激活模型10%-15%的参数,显著降低显存占用;
  3. 渐进式训练:采用课程学习策略,从简单任务逐步过渡到复杂场景,提升模型泛化能力。

二、云端部署架构设计:从理论到实践

1. 基础设施选型

  • 计算资源:推荐NVIDIA A100/H100 GPU,配合AMD EPYC处理器,平衡算力与性价比;
  • 存储方案:采用对象存储(如AWS S3)与块存储(如Azure Disk)混合模式,分别存储模型权重与临时数据;
  • 网络拓扑:使用VPC对等连接实现跨区域数据同步,带宽建议不低于10Gbps。

代码示例:Kubernetes部署配置

  1. apiVersion: apps/v1
  2. kind: Deployment
  3. metadata:
  4. name: deepseek-assistant
  5. spec:
  6. replicas: 3
  7. selector:
  8. matchLabels:
  9. app: deepseek
  10. template:
  11. metadata:
  12. labels:
  13. app: deepseek
  14. spec:
  15. containers:
  16. - name: model-server
  17. image: deepseek/model-server:latest
  18. resources:
  19. limits:
  20. nvidia.com/gpu: 1
  21. memory: "16Gi"
  22. requests:
  23. cpu: "2"
  24. memory: "8Gi"
  25. env:
  26. - name: MODEL_PATH
  27. value: "s3://models/deepseek-v1.5"

2. 模型优化策略

  • 量化压缩:使用FP8混合精度训练,模型体积减少50%而精度损失<2%;
  • 动态批处理:通过TensorRT实现动态批处理,吞吐量提升3倍;
  • 持续预训练:针对特定领域(如医疗、法律)进行领域适应训练,提升专业场景表现。

三、部署流程:五步实现零门槛上云

1. 环境准备

  • 安装NVIDIA驱动(版本≥525.85.12)与CUDA Toolkit(12.2+);
  • 部署Kubernetes集群,配置GPU节点池;
  • 初始化模型仓库(推荐使用Hugging Face Hub或私有MinIO)。

2. 模型转换

将PyTorch格式的DeepSeek模型转换为ONNX或TensorRT引擎:

  1. import torch
  2. from transformers import AutoModelForCausalLM
  3. model = AutoModelForCausalLM.from_pretrained("deepseek/v1.5")
  4. dummy_input = torch.randn(1, 32, 1024) # batch_size=1, seq_len=32, hidden_dim=1024
  5. # 导出为ONNX
  6. torch.onnx.export(
  7. model,
  8. dummy_input,
  9. "deepseek.onnx",
  10. input_names=["input_ids"],
  11. output_names=["logits"],
  12. dynamic_axes={
  13. "input_ids": {0: "batch_size", 1: "seq_length"},
  14. "logits": {0: "batch_size", 1: "seq_length"}
  15. }
  16. )

3. 服务化部署

  • 使用Triton Inference Server封装模型,支持HTTP/gRPC双协议;
  • 配置自动扩缩容策略(HPA),基于CPU/GPU利用率触发扩容。

4. 监控体系构建

  • Prometheus采集GPU温度、显存占用等指标;
  • Grafana可视化面板实时展示QPS、P99延迟等关键指标;
  • 集成Alertmanager实现异常告警。

四、性能调优:突破部署瓶颈

1. 延迟优化

  • 内核融合:将LayerNorm、GELU等操作合并为单个CUDA内核;
  • 内存复用:通过CUDA统一内存管理,减少主机与设备间数据拷贝;
  • 请求批处理:设置max_batch_size=64,平衡延迟与吞吐量。

2. 成本优化

  • Spot实例:使用AWS Spot实例或Azure低优先级VM,成本降低70%;
  • 模型蒸馏:将DeepSeek-7B蒸馏为3B版本,推理成本下降60%;
  • 缓存层:引入Redis缓存高频问答,减少模型调用次数。

五、安全与合规:构建可信AI服务

1. 数据安全

  • 实施传输层加密(TLS 1.3)与静态数据加密(AES-256);
  • 采用差分隐私技术处理用户数据,ε值控制在0.5以内。

2. 访问控制

  • 基于RBAC的权限管理,区分管理员、开发者、普通用户角色;
  • 集成OAuth 2.0实现第三方认证,支持JWT令牌验证。

3. 合规审计

  • 记录所有API调用日志,保留期限≥180天;
  • 定期进行渗透测试,修复OWASP Top 10漏洞。

六、进阶场景:多模态与边缘部署

1. 多模态扩展

  • 集成Vision Transformer(ViT)处理图像输入;
  • 使用Whisper模型实现语音交互,构建全场景AI助手。

2. 边缘计算部署

  • 通过TensorRT Lite将模型转换为FPGA可执行文件;
  • 在NVIDIA Jetson AGX Orin上部署,功耗仅30W。

七、行业实践:金融领域部署案例

某银行信用卡中心部署DeepSeek后,实现以下突破:

  • 智能客服:解答准确率从82%提升至95%,单日处理量达10万次;
  • 反欺诈系统:结合图神经网络,将欺诈交易识别时间从5分钟缩短至8秒;
  • 成本节约:年度IT支出减少400万元,ROI达300%。

结语:拥抱AI助手的新纪元

DeepSeek的崛起标志着AI部署从”重资产”向”轻量化”的转型。通过云端弹性架构与优化技术,开发者可在24小时内完成从模型下载到服务上线的全流程。未来,随着模型压缩与硬件协同技术的演进,专属AI助手的部署成本将进一步降低,推动AI技术普惠化进程。建议开发者持续关注模型量化、异构计算等前沿领域,构建面向未来的AI基础设施。

相关文章推荐

发表评论